Kane, Ndombele, Reguilon: Tottenham's latest injury updates ahead of Chelsea showdown

Tottenham are set to face Chelsea on Wednesday as Premier League action continues. Spurs suffered a surprise 1-0 loss to Brighton over the weekend and will be looking to securing an important three points. And ahead of the game here are the latest injury updates and team news of Spurs. Harry Kane has suffered knocks to both ankles during Liverpool game and head coach Jose Mourinho has since confirmed Spurs striker will be out for around three weeks in all, ruling him out for the Chelsea clash. Tanguy Ndombele was injured during the Brighton game, as he was limped off with just over 15 minutes remaining with some sort of injury. And there is no update from Mourinho yet. Sergio Reguilon will be ruled out for several weeks due to a muscle injury, according to the Evening Standard. The left-back is likely to miss the game against Chelsea on Thursday, as well as fixtures with West Brom on February 6, Everton in the FA Cup on February 10, and possibly Manchester City three days later. Dele Alli has struggled for game time under Mourinho, however, it seems his most recent omissions have been due to a 'small tendon injury'. His return date is till unknown. Giovani Lo Celso picked up a hamstring injury on December 20 during Spurs' last defeat, a 2-0 loss at the hands of Leicester City.
